Ich habe versucht, über die Schaltfläche oder manuell zu installieren, erhalte aber immer wieder 500-Fehler oder werde auf unserer Website zu 404 weitergeleitet. Bin ich der Einzige?
Hallo, ich hatte keine Probleme, die Komponente zu installieren.
Funktioniert es nicht, wenn du die Komponente manuell mit dem Repository installierst:
Ich habe es gerade installiert und es hat funktioniert, ohne den Fehler, den Sie sehen. Verwenden Sie die richtige URL zum GitHub-Repository? Sollte sein
https://github.com/thebestgoodguy/vibecommit-hero.git
Es liegt möglicherweise an Ihrer Discourse-Version und der Tatsache, dass bei der Übernahme der vielseitigen Bannerkomponente die Kompatibilitätsdatei nicht gelöscht wurde. Ich vermute, dass der dort angegebene Commit nicht im aktuellen Repository gefunden werden kann, da er zum vielseitigen Banner gehört.
Das .git am Ende der URL hat es behoben! Danke!
Es sieht so aus, als hättest du ein neues Theme erstellt. Du müsstest “aus einem Git-Repository” auswählen. Aber ich schätze, das wird fehlschlagen
Ich habe es gerade auch noch einmal ohne das .git am Ende versucht, und es funktioniert bei mir immer noch.
Also ja, es sieht so aus, als ob Moin mit ihrem Rat auf dem richtigen Weg sein könnte. Hast du deine Website auf den neuesten Stand gebracht? Hast du bereits eine andere Komponente installiert, die Konflikte verursacht?
Die Fehlerbehandlung ist hier ziemlich miserabel – es wäre schön, wenn eine bessere Fehlermeldung angezeigt werden könnte!
Kannst du überprüfen, ob in der JavaScript-Konsole mehr/bessere Informationen darüber angezeigt werden, was schief geht?
Ja, ich habe es auf unserem Staging-Server versucht, wo wir 3.5 haben. Vielleicht ist es das vielseitige Banner, das wir haben, das Konflikte verursacht. Auf jeden Fall vielen Dank an alle für die Hilfe.
Lassen Sie uns wissen, ob das funktioniert. Ich werde dies in ein neues #support-Thema verschieben, damit wir es abschließen können.
Es gibt einen Fehler in .discourse-compatibility
< 3.6.0.beta1-dev: 9f248e18b35e4cf599e35a871e9348957077e7c6
Dieser Commit existiert nicht, daher wird er nicht auf 3.5.1 stable installiert.
Das passiert, wenn man etwas „forkt“, aber den gesamten Git-Verlauf verwirft.

